Writing Modes PR & Testsuite

Yesterday, we resolved to publish either a CR or, preferably if the
Process allows it, a PR of Writing Modes Level 3.

However, I'm unconvinced we have a testsuite sufficient to leave CR
(and proceed to PR) with; we seem to have hundreds of reftests which
fail due to anti-aliasing differences.

According to the test harness, Firefox passes 89.02% of the testsuite
(which it makes out to be 1120 tests); running locally all automated
tests, I get 1045 tests (910 parents, 135 subtests; as far as I'm
aware the harness has no notion of harnesses), of which 457 pass and
588 fail: this implies that 89.02% of the entire testsuite cannot
pass.

Looking into many of the failures, it quickly became apparent that
hundreds of these failures is down to anti-aliasing differences in
reftests; I've filed a bug for this at
<https://github.com/w3c/csswg-test/issues/1174>.

As such, I at least don't view the testsuite as ready to publish a PR
and would raise a formal objection if we resolved to do so.
